FM Approval
Factory Mutual Research (FM) conforming to
Approval Standard Class Number 3611, 3600, 3810
ANSI/UL 61010-1
ANSI/UL 121201
ANSI/NEMA 250
CSA-C22.2 No. 94
CSA C22.2 No. 213
CSA C22.2 No. 61010-1
Devices with article numbers -...1
Devices with article numbers -...0
Approved for use in
Class I, II, III, Division 2, Group A, B, C,
D, F, G; T4
Class I, Zone 2, Group IIC T4
Zone 22, Group IIIA, IIIB T135°C
non-hazardous locations
Approved for use in
Class I, Division 2, Group A, B, C, D; T4
Class I, Zone 2, Group IIC T4
non-hazardous locations
Installation instructions for cFMus:
WARNING Do not remove or replace while circuit is live when a flammable or combustible
atmosphere is present.
WARNING Substitution of components may impair suitability of the equipment.
CAUTION To prevent injury, read the manual before use.
Additional instructions for cFMus, built-in devices:
WARNING The equipment is intended to be installed within an enclosure/control cabinet.
The inner service temperature of the enclosure/control cabinet corresponds to the ambient
temperature of the module. Use cables with a maximum permitted operating temperature of
at least 20 °C higher than the maximum ambient temperature.
ATEX/UKEX/IECEx approval
Notes on use in hazardous areas
Observe the following FAQ regarding the use of an HMI device in hazardous areas: ATEX-FAQ
(https://support.industry.siemens.com/cs/ww/en/view/291285)
When using the device in hazardous areas, ensure that all plugs connected to the device are
secured in a captive manner, see section "Securing cables for use in hazardous areas
(Page 68)".
